So I started collecting parts for this about 2 years ago. I finally got funds to get one built. It started out as a hk USC, it's a polymer reciever so an ump rear stub was fused to a cut USC reciever. Then cerokoted ral8000. Then he added the black and the German brown. Adco cut and threaded the barrel. Got a tirant 45 due to arrive next week, which will have the same color scheme. It will be topped with an aimpoint pro. The black USC I just added a hdps stock block with ump stock and lower. I have not cut vents or the reciever to accept the 25 rnd ump mags. Also it still has the 16" barrel.
